The only constructive criticism I could give is for them to not serve their beers in frosted glasses/pitchers as this keeps the beers from warming up and blooming with flavor and can also water down your beers. When drinking a Coors or Bud, you want it as cold as possible but with the nicer craft beers, you get more flavor sans frosted glass. However, it’s worth noting that they serve pitchers of select craft beers, which is not an option at most other beer spots and may be an attractive option if you’re with a group.
